What Your Options Are For Mortgage Loans

Topics: mortgage, mortgage loan, real estate, equity, short refinance loan, fixed loans, adjustable loans

Mortgage loans are loans taken out to pay for homes or any real estate property. The cost of the home is spread out over several years, with a monthly interest added as payment for the loan itself. In the United States, mortgage loans may last 10, 15, 20, 30, or 40 years. Mortgage loans are secured with the home; that is, the lender can claim the home if the borrower fails to keep up with the payments. Since the home itself serves as security, the loan requires no other collateral. The person taking out the loan is called the mortgagor, and the lender is called the mortgagee.

Types of mortgage loans

There are several types of mortgage loans, each suitable for specific situations. The most common types are fixed rate, adjustable rate, and balloon loans.

Fixed rate mortgage loans

In a fixed rate loan, the interest rate stays the same throughout the term of the loan. Consequently, the monthly payment does not change, regardless of the prevailing market rates. This offers more stability for the mortgagor, but at the price of higher interest rates.

Fixed rate mortgage loans usually last 15 or more years. When the mortgagee grants a long term loan, they take on the risk of rising interest rates. This means that if the prime interest rate goes up, the lender, instead of the borrower, will pay the difference.

Adjustable rate mortgage loans

Adjustable rate loans start with a fixed rate for the first three to seven years, and then switch to an adjustable rate after the initial period. In this type of loan, the interest rate changes according to the market rates. This means the mortgagor assumes the risk throughout the loan. When the market rates go up, the buyer pays the higher interest rate. As a sort of incentive, the interest rate for the initial period is lower than that of the fixed rate loan.

Balloon mortgage loans

Also called a reset mortgage, a balloon mortgage loan starts with a very low fixed rate for seven to 10 years. After that, the buyer has to pay off the entire balance. Many people take out these mortgage loans and refinance their homes before it reaches the balloon phase. However, the risk in this scheme is that there is no way to predict the interest rates at the time of refinancing.

Refinancing mortgage loans

A common technique is to refinance a home while paying off a mortgage loan. This helps the owner find lower interest rates, reduce monthly payments, or avoid the risk of long term commitments. Refinancing can be done with most types of mortgage loans, depending on the mortgagors situation.

The simplest type involves switching between two adjustable rate mortgage loans. This is useful when the new loan has lower rates or shorter terms. It is also possible to switch between different types of mortgage loans, such as adjustable rate to fixed rate, or vice versa. The latter is usually done after the initial fixed rate period to maintain stability. Fixed to adjustable rates are ideal for people who do not plan to stay in the home for a long time, and thus may not find mortgage loans profitable.
